Defined by its heritage, this 1976 Camper & Nicholson Ketch 42 offers a blend of classic design and updated mechanical reliability. The vessel underwent a significant refit period between 2001 and 2009, which included an anti-osmosis treatment, hull painting, and a reinforced mast. The interior and exterior were modernized with new internal sofa upholstery in 2004, a teak cockpit installed in 2001, and the addition of a bow thruster in 2001 to enhance maneuverability.
Propulsion is provided by a 93hp Perkins engine, which has been overhauled and shows approximately 50 hours of operation since the revision. The technical side of the boat benefits from 2003 upgrades to the hydraulic and electrical systems, alongside a 2001 Yanmar generator. Navigational electronics were updated in 2001 via Simrad instruments. The ketch rig includes a versatile sail inventory, with replacements and additions made between 2000 and 2011, including a 2011 set of sails.
Designed with two cabins and two heads, the layout accommodates up to 12 people, making it suitable for those who appreciate the craftsmanship of a historic sailing yacht. The vessel is currently located in the Emilia Romagna region of Italy and has been stored on the hard for the last two seasons. This used boat is offered with VAT paid status.
